#399AED Hex color

#399AED

The hexadecimal color code #399AED corresponds to the code RGB( 57, 154, 237 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,22 level), green (at 0,60 level) and blue (at 0,93 level). Its brightness is 57% and its saturation is 83%. It is composed of red at 12%, green at 34% and blue at 52%.
